## BounceHerder Environment Variables

BounceHerder, our email bounce processor, reads its configuration entirely from the environment at startup. `BH_POLL_INTERVAL` controls how often the Marlowby queue is drained, and `BH_MAX_RETRIES` caps redelivery attempts before a recipient is suppressed. Misconfiguring either causes silent suppression drift, so double-check staging before promoting. To classify bounces it must authenticate with the Fennwick mailbox gateway, and that credential is set by the very next line.

sealed setting: RELAY_SECRET5=82864

Canary gating at Vextrel is non-negotiable. Every deploy to Pylon services starts at 2% traffic. Promotion requires 30 minutes clean on error rate, latency p99, and saturation. Any gate failure auto-rolls back; do not override without a sign-off from the on-call lead. Manual promotions are logged and audited weekly. Full gating rules and thresholds live on the internal page below.

wiki page, tahaf-tajog: https://jira.ordindyn.corp/pipeline

## Action Item: RateGuard parity checker — stale feed detection

During the incident, RateGuard silently compared against a partner feed that was nine hours stale, producing false parity violations for most of the morning. Add a freshness check that fails closed when feed timestamps exceed the configured threshold, and surface the feed age in every alert payload. Reviewer: verify the threshold defaults documented on the page below.

runbook for kagap-tawep: https://jira.tolvaqcorp.corp/browse/job/view/7f34cad8e4ed

## Canary Gating for Plugin Releases

All third-party plugins on the Lanternhub platform pass through a canary stage: 5% of traffic for one hour, auto-rollback if error rate exceeds baseline by 0.5%. Gating decisions are recorded per release in the gate_events table, which you can query for your plugin. Read-only access uses the connection string below.

replica DSN, yahog-kawig: redis://istox_svc:um@db-8a67.halixforge.test:5432/frawyn